#include "ble/dfu.h"
|
|
#include "ble/messages.h"
|
|
|
|
/// package: trezorio.ble
|
|
|
|
/// INTERNAL: int # interface id for internal (stm<->nrf) connection
|
|
/// EXTERNAL: int # interface id for ble client connection
|
|
|
|
/// def update_init(data: bytes, binsize: int) -> bool:
|
|
/// """
|
|
/// Initializes the BLE firmware update. Returns true if the update finished
|
|
/// with only the initial chunk. False means calling `update_chunk` is
|
|
/// expected.
|
|
/// """
|
|
STATIC mp_obj_t mod_trezorio_BLE_update_init(mp_obj_t data, mp_obj_t binsize) {
|
|
mp_buffer_info_t buffer = {0};
|
|
mp_int_t binsize_int = mp_obj_get_int(binsize);
|
|
|
|
mp_get_buffer_raise(data, &buffer, MP_BUFFER_READ);
|
|
|
|
ble_set_dfu_mode(true);
|
|
|
|
dfu_result_t result = dfu_update_init(buffer.buf, buffer.len, binsize_int);
|
|
if (result == DFU_NEXT_CHUNK) {
|
|
return mp_const_false;
|
|
} else if (result == DFU_SUCCESS) {
|
|
ble_set_dfu_mode(false);
|
|
return mp_const_true;
|
|
} else {
|
|
ble_set_dfu_mode(false);
|
|
mp_raise_msg(&mp_type_RuntimeError, "Upload failed.");
|
|
}
|
|
}
|
|
STATIC MP_DEFINE_CONST_FUN_OBJ_2(mod_trezorio_BLE_update_init_obj,
|
|
mod_trezorio_BLE_update_init);
|
|
|
|
/// def update_chunk(chunk: bytes) -> bool:
|
|
/// """
|
|
/// Writes next chunk of BLE firmware update. Returns true if the update is
|
|
/// finished, or false if more chunks are expected.
|
|
/// """
|
|
STATIC mp_obj_t mod_trezorio_BLE_update_chunk(mp_obj_t data) {
|
|
mp_buffer_info_t buffer = {0};
|
|
|
|
mp_get_buffer_raise(data, &buffer, MP_BUFFER_READ);
|
|
|
|
dfu_result_t result = dfu_update_chunk(buffer.buf, buffer.len);
|
|
|
|
if (result == DFU_NEXT_CHUNK) {
|
|
return mp_const_false;
|
|
} else if (result == DFU_SUCCESS) {
|
|
ble_set_dfu_mode(false);
|
|
return mp_const_true;
|
|
} else {
|
|
ble_set_dfu_mode(false);
|
|
mp_raise_msg(&mp_type_RuntimeError, "Upload failed.");
|
|
}
|
|
}
|
|
STATIC MP_DEFINE_CONST_FUN_OBJ_1(mod_trezorio_BLE_update_chunk_obj,
|
|
mod_trezorio_BLE_update_chunk);
|
|
|
|
/// def write_int(self, msg: bytes) -> int:
|
|
/// """
|
|
/// Sends internal message to NRF.
|
|
/// """
|
|
STATIC mp_obj_t mod_trezorio_BLE_write_int(mp_obj_t self, mp_obj_t msg) {
|
|
mp_buffer_info_t buf = {0};
|
|
mp_get_buffer_raise(msg, &buf, MP_BUFFER_READ);
|
|
ble_int_comm_send(buf.buf, buf.len, INTERNAL_MESSAGE);
|
|
return MP_OBJ_NEW_SMALL_INT(buf.len);
|
|
}
|
|
STATIC MP_DEFINE_CONST_FUN_OBJ_2(mod_trezorio_BLE_write_int_obj,
|
|
mod_trezorio_BLE_write_int);
|
|
|
|
/// def write_ext(self, msg: bytes) -> int:
|
|
/// """
|
|
/// Sends message over BLE
|
|
/// """
|
|
STATIC mp_obj_t mod_trezorio_BLE_write_ext(mp_obj_t self, mp_obj_t msg) {
|
|
mp_buffer_info_t buf = {0};
|
|
mp_get_buffer_raise(msg, &buf, MP_BUFFER_READ);
|
|
ble_int_comm_send(buf.buf, buf.len, EXTERNAL_MESSAGE);
|
|
return MP_OBJ_NEW_SMALL_INT(buf.len);
|
|
}
|
|
STATIC MP_DEFINE_CONST_FUN_OBJ_2(mod_trezorio_BLE_write_ext_obj,
|
|
mod_trezorio_BLE_write_ext);
|
|
|
|
/// def erase_bonds() -> None:
|
|
/// """
|
|
/// Erases all BLE bonds
|
|
/// """
|
|
STATIC mp_obj_t mod_trezorio_BLE_erase_bonds(void) {
|
|
bool result = send_erase_bonds();
|
|
if (result) {
|
|
return mp_const_none;
|
|
} else {
|
|
mp_raise_msg(&mp_type_RuntimeError, "Erase bonds failed.");
|
|
}
|
|
}
|
|
STATIC MP_DEFINE_CONST_FUN_OBJ_0(mod_trezorio_BLE_erase_bonds_obj,
|
|
mod_trezorio_BLE_erase_bonds);
|
|
|
|
/// def start_comm() -> None:
|
|
/// """
|
|
/// Start communication with BLE chip
|
|
/// """
|
|
STATIC mp_obj_t mod_trezorio_BLE_start_comm(void) {
|
|
ble_comm_start();
|
|
auto_start_advertising();
|
|
return mp_const_none;
|
|
}
|
|
STATIC MP_DEFINE_CONST_FUN_OBJ_0(mod_trezorio_BLE_start_comm_obj,
|
|
mod_trezorio_BLE_start_comm);
|
|
|
|
/// def start_advertising(whitelist: bool) -> None:
|
|
/// """
|
|
/// Start advertising
|
|
/// """
|
|
STATIC mp_obj_t mod_trezorio_BLE_start_advertising(mp_obj_t whitelist) {
|
|
bool whitelist_bool = mp_obj_is_true(whitelist);
|
|
|
|
start_advertising(whitelist_bool);
|
|
return mp_const_none;
|
|
}
|
|
STATIC MP_DEFINE_CONST_FUN_OBJ_1(mod_trezorio_BLE_start_advertising_obj,
|
|
mod_trezorio_BLE_start_advertising);
|
|
|
|
/// def stop_advertising(whitelist: bool) -> None:
|
|
/// """
|
|
/// Stop advertising
|
|
/// """
|
|
STATIC mp_obj_t mod_trezorio_BLE_stop_advertising(void) {
|
|
ble_comm_start();
|
|
return mp_const_none;
|
|
}
|
|
STATIC MP_DEFINE_CONST_FUN_OBJ_0(mod_trezorio_BLE_stop_advertising_obj,
|
|
mod_trezorio_BLE_stop_advertising);
|
|
|
|
/// def disconnect() -> None:
|
|
/// """
|
|
/// Disconnect BLE
|
|
/// """
|
|
STATIC mp_obj_t mod_trezorio_BLE_disconnect(void) {
|
|
bool result = send_disconnect();
|
|
if (result) {
|
|
return mp_const_none;
|
|
} else {
|
|
mp_raise_msg(&mp_type_RuntimeError, "Disconnect failed.");
|
|
}
|
|
}
|
|
STATIC MP_DEFINE_CONST_FUN_OBJ_0(mod_trezorio_BLE_disconnect_obj,
|
|
mod_trezorio_BLE_disconnect);
|
|
|
|
STATIC const mp_rom_map_elem_t mod_trezorio_BLE_globals_table[] = {
|
|
{MP_ROM_QSTR(MP_QSTR_INTERNAL), MP_ROM_INT(BLE_IFACE_INT)},
|
|
{MP_ROM_QSTR(MP_QSTR_EXTERNAL), MP_ROM_INT(BLE_IFACE_EXT)},
|
|
{MP_ROM_QSTR(MP_QSTR___name__), MP_ROM_QSTR(MP_QSTR_ble)},
|
|
{MP_ROM_QSTR(MP_QSTR_update_init),
|
|
MP_ROM_PTR(&mod_trezorio_BLE_update_init_obj)},
|
|
{MP_ROM_QSTR(MP_QSTR_update_chunk),
|
|
MP_ROM_PTR(&mod_trezorio_BLE_update_chunk_obj)},
|
|
{MP_ROM_QSTR(MP_QSTR_write_int),
|
|
MP_ROM_PTR(&mod_trezorio_BLE_write_int_obj)},
|
|
{MP_ROM_QSTR(MP_QSTR_write_ext),
|
|
MP_ROM_PTR(&mod_trezorio_BLE_write_ext_obj)},
|
|
{MP_ROM_QSTR(MP_QSTR_erase_bonds),
|
|
MP_ROM_PTR(&mod_trezorio_BLE_erase_bonds_obj)},
|
|
{MP_ROM_QSTR(MP_QSTR_start_comm),
|
|
MP_ROM_PTR(&mod_trezorio_BLE_start_comm_obj)},
|
|
{MP_ROM_QSTR(MP_QSTR_start_advertising),
|
|
MP_ROM_PTR(&mod_trezorio_BLE_start_advertising_obj)},
|
|
{MP_ROM_QSTR(MP_QSTR_stop_advertising),
|
|
MP_ROM_PTR(&mod_trezorio_BLE_stop_advertising_obj)},
|
|
{MP_ROM_QSTR(MP_QSTR_disconnect),
|
|
MP_ROM_PTR(&mod_trezorio_BLE_disconnect_obj)},
|
|
};
|
|
STATIC MP_DEFINE_CONST_DICT(mod_trezorio_BLE_globals,
|
|
mod_trezorio_BLE_globals_table);
|
|
|
|
STATIC const mp_obj_module_t mod_trezorio_BLE_module = {
|
|
.base = {&mp_type_module},
|
|
.globals = (mp_obj_dict_t *)&mod_trezorio_BLE_globals};
